About the Game

You are a prisoner, in the decrepit basement of a man live streaming your every action to the world. To survive you are forced to entertain your audience at all costs. Mind the rats.

Main Features Include

  • A hammer to crush rats with
  • Multiple ways to entertain viewers, such as eating rats
  • Dynamic chat, see how your actions entertain the masses


    Use a hammer to crush your enemies (The rats if you couldn't guess)


    Dig your way to freedom when you have the chance
